Subject: Handover — Quillbase config hot-reload

Tavi,

Before I'm out: the hot-reload daemon on Quillbase now watches /etc/quillbase/live.toml and applies pool-size and timeout changes without restart. Do NOT hot-reload auth settings — those still require a bounce, and the daemon will silently ignore them, which bit us last sprint. Reload events log to the ops channel. If the watcher wedges, restart quillbase-reloader only, not the primary. For verifying reloads against the staging replica, connect with the string below.

— Orna

replica DSN, kajep-yahag: mssql://praok_svc:iF@db-8d68.plorvaio.local:5432/eliion

Ticket: Staging env misconfigured for Siftgate bloom filter

The bloom layer in front of the Pellet KV store is rejecting all lookups in staging because the env file was copied from the dev template without credentials. False-positive tuning values are fine; only the auth line is missing. To unblock the weekly demo, the Pellet admission secret must be set on the following line.

env line for yaguf-fajop: LEDGER_TOKEN13=fb08984397349

For the weekly sync. Shrinkhart batch-resizes product imagery; break-glass applies when the CLI's signing key expires mid-run and jobs stall. Procedure: cancel in-flight batches, mark outputs untrusted, rotate via the emergency keygen on the ops box. Do not re-sign partial outputs. Emergency keygen is gated — two approvals plus manual unlock. Log the incident before unlocking, not after; auditors check ordering. Once approvals land, open the unlock prompt on the ops box. It accepts the recovery passphrase given below.

unlock words, yawig-kagef: gordor-holvan-ulaael-pramir-ulaiel-tamdor